Our Vision

We envision a growing spirit of unity among God’s people, encouraging meaningful change in our city.

Our Mission

Together LA enhances the positive impact of faith-inspired individuals, churches, and organizations committed to the well-being of people across Los Angeles.

What We Do

Celebrate

We tell stories to honor those investing in others and highlight God’s work in our city.

Connect

We foster relationships believing these connections are essential to strengthening the good work already happening.

Contribute

We work creatively to offer helpful resources to support individual and organizational needs.

Our Values

We Start with Jesus

We believe that life with Jesus changes everything—our perspectives, our purpose, and our relationships. He is the foundation of all we do, and we strive to reflect his love, grace, and truth in every interaction. Our work is not about personal gain or recognition but about honoring and pleasing Jesus in how we serve our city and one another.

Every Person Matters

Our city is rich in diversity, and we believe every individual—regardless of background, status, or story—is made in the image of God. This conviction compels us to treat each person with dignity, respect, and compassion. We listen, engage, and advocate for one another, ensuring that everyone feels seen, heard, and valued.

We Focus on What Unites Us

In a world often divided by differences, we choose a different way. Rather than allowing disagreements to create barriers, we prioritize our shared love for Jesus, our commitment to our city, and our desire to serve others. By focusing on what brings us together, we cultivate unity, collaboration, and lasting impact.

Curiosity Motivates Us

We believe understanding begins with listening, learning, and asking good questions. Rather than reacting or assuming, we approach people and challenges with humility.

Theological Distinction

Together LA’s vision, mission, and values are derived from our Christian theological orientation and convictions. We begin with our belief in the Triune God, His love for His creation, the good news of what Jesus accomplished in his life, death, and resurrection, and our call to follow him. We do not expect to agree on everything, however, we believe these foundational Christian beliefs can form a foundation for cultivating significant relationships.
